The Heartbeat of Inclusivity: What Defines a Great LGBTQ+ Bar?
What makes a particular venue stand out in the vibrant tapestry of queer nightlife? It's often a combination of atmosphere, entertainment, and an undeniable sense of belonging. Beyond just serving your favorite cocktail, the best LGBTQ+ bars are designed with community at their core.
Expect to find features that cater to a wide spectrum of preferences:
- Dynamic Entertainment: From spectacular drag performances that redefine artistry and glamour, to weekly karaoke nights where everyone's a star, and live music or DJs spinning everything from pop anthems to deep house beats.
- Diverse Theme Nights: Many venues host special evenings like "Underwear Night," "Leather Night," or "Country Western Night," offering unique opportunities to connect with specific sub-communities and express different facets of identity.
- Welcoming Ambiance: A truly inclusive space prioritizes a friendly, easygoing vibe, ensuring that newcomers feel just as comfortable as long-time regulars. Bartenders and staff often contribute significantly to this welcoming atmosphere.
- Varied Layouts: Look for options like expansive dance floors, quieter lounge areas for intimate chats, lively outdoor patios perfect for warm evenings, and even silent disco zones for a unique auditory experience.
- Community Hubs: These venues often serve as anchors for local Pride events, fundraisers, and social gatherings, reinforcing their role beyond just a place to drink.
An exceptional LGBTQ+ bar isn't just a place to grab a drink; it's a sanctuary where authenticity thrives, friendships are forged, and every individual is encouraged to shine.

Houston, Texas: A Diverse Tapestry of Queer Nightlife
Houston, affectionately known as "H-Town," boasts an extensive array of LGBTQ+ bars, ensuring there's a perfect spot for every taste, mood, and occasion. The city's Montrose neighborhood is particularly recognized as a gayborhood, with many establishments within easy reach of each other.
- South Beach Houston: A true nightlife titan, South Beach offers an immense dance floor and a spacious rear patio. Guests often enjoy complimentary admission early in the evening, inviting revelers to dance the night away beneath a massive, glittering chandelier.
- The Eagle Houston: A cornerstone for the leather and bear communities, The Eagle is known for its energetic pop music scene upstairs and a vibrant patio/deck that's perfect for people-watching and socializing. It's a place where "tough guys" and all others looking to "let their freak flag fly" feel completely at home, with rotating themed events adding to the excitement.
- Crocker Bar: This lively spot is famous for its happy hour specials and resident DJs, making it an ideal choice for those looking to dance, unwind, or enjoy some pub grub on their patio.
- Pearl Bar Houston: A historically significant venue, Pearl Bar consistently hosts a packed calendar of DJs, concerts, drag shows, and engaging events. Its large back patio provides ample seating for those needing a break from the dance floor or an intimate conversation.
- Barcode: Known for its stacked weekly drag show schedule, Barcode also offers popular karaoke nights. It's a friendly, intimate setting perfect for belting out your favorite tunes.
- Tony's Corner Pocket: A quintessential country gay bar in the Montrose area, Tony's Corner Pocket is perfect for those who love line dancing, two-stepping, or simply enjoying country vibes. With pool tables, dart boards, sports on TV, and even steak and taco nights, it's a beloved local haunt.
- Esquire Room: For the show tune aficionados and crooners, this hidden gem offers live piano accompaniment for sing-alongs throughout the week. It's an intimate setting where guests gather around the piano for a communal musical experience.
- Neon Boots: Spanning over 10,000 square feet, Neon Boots is a massive entertainment complex featuring an enormous dance floor, multiple bar stations, a side lounge, live shows, Latin nights, and dance lessons. It's a comprehensive destination for a fun-filled night out.
- RIPCORD: With a large indoor space and an inviting outdoor patio, RIPCORD caters to leather enthusiasts and anyone seeking a lively, uninhibited atmosphere where self-expression is paramount.
Salt Lake City, Utah: Surprising Vibrancy in the Beehive State
Defying preconceptions, Salt Lake City boasts a surprisingly robust and celebrated LGBTQ+ scene, particularly highlighted by its large and festive Pride Week festivities, which draw tens of thousands to the downtown area in a riot of rainbow colors.
- Club Try-Angles: This venue is cherished for its welcoming, chill vibe, though it transforms into an epic party during themed events like Underwear Night or Leather Night. Expect friendly bartenders and a diverse crowd, making it perfect for solo explorers or newcomers to the city's scene. Don't forget to sample their uniquely named, colorful cocktails.
- Metro Music Hall: A key player in Salt Lake City's entertainment landscape, Metro Music Hall frequently hosts high-energy drag shows and gender-swap events, showcasing both local and visiting performers.
- Twilite Lounge: Stepping into Twilite Lounge feels like a pleasant journey back in time. This total throwback experience offers an atmosphere that is as welcoming as it is diverse, providing a relaxed setting for all.
- Bar X: For those who appreciate a more refined yet intimate setting, Bar X offers a sultry, speakeasy vibe. Their must-try cocktails and cool ambiance create the perfect backdrop for cozying up at a corner table, no matter your preference.

Finding Your Perfect Spot: Tips for Exploring the Scene
Navigating the rich variety of LGBTQ+ nightlife can be an exciting adventure. Here are a few tips to enhance your experience:
- Check Event Calendars: Many bars maintain active social media pages or websites where they post weekly events, from drag shows and karaoke to themed parties and happy hour specials. This is the best way to catch exactly what you're looking for.
- Go with the Flow: Whether you prefer a quiet conversation or a full-on dance party, be open to different experiences. Some nights a venue might be mellow, while others it's bustling.
- Support Local: Every visit to an LGBTQ+ bar helps sustain these vital community spaces. Your patronage directly supports inclusive businesses.
- Prioritize Safety: Always be aware of your surroundings, drink responsibly, and plan your transportation. These spaces are generally very safe, but personal vigilance is always wise.
